        Oilfield biocides can be described as chemicals associated with oilfields which are important for enhancing the biodegradability level and for decreasing toxicity levels in oilfields. Oilfield biocides assist in meeting oilfield application requirements where operations are subject to different processes.
        Oxidizing biocides are extensively used in various applications including commercial cleaning and industrial processes as a chemical agent since they are ideal for destroying microorganisms.
        Oilfield biocides are used in different stages of various industrial processes including packer fluids and drilling. Oxidizing oilfield biocides are highly preferred over non-oxidizing agents because they are ideal for cases where the oilfield microbial growth is too high. Oxidizing biocides are more reactive and persistent than the non-oxidizing biocides and as a result, the coming years will witness a positive increase in the demand for oxidizing oilfield biocide chemicals.
